summ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orChristian Grothoff <christian@grothoff.org>2023-01-17 22:01:38 +0100
committerChristian Grothoff <christian@grothoff.org>2023-01-17 22:01:38 +0100
commita91a6ba1f690062a682f5d753bf80bd24a4407f8 (patch)
tree6beff3810bdecdb2633d87e8e26cda919eba9c4c
parent4ae2d095b860ab4f476b2ed7df8123a5618bacd6 (diff)
downloadanastasis-a91a6ba1f690062a682f5d753bf80bd24a4407f8.tar.gz
anastasis-a91a6ba1f690062a682f5d753bf80bd24a4407f8.tar.bz2
anastasis-a91a6ba1f690062a682f5d753bf80bd24a4407f8.zip
Taler 0.9.0 migrations for cli tests
-rwxr-xr-xsrc/cli/test_anastasis_reducer_recovery_enter_user_attributes.sh20
1 files changed, 12 insertions, 8 deletions
diff --git a/src/cli/test_anastasis_reducer_recovery_enter_user_attributes.sh b/src/cli/test_anastasis_reducer_recovery_enter_user_attributes.sh
index b32dd5d..4efbe6b 100755
--- a/src/cli/test_anastasis_reducer_recovery_enter_user_attributes.sh
+++ b/src/cli/test_anastasis_reducer_recovery_enter_user_attributes.sh
@@ -393,17 +393,18 @@ echo " OK"
echo -n "Preparing wallet"
rm $WALLET_DB
-taler-wallet-cli --no-throttle --wallet-db=$WALLET_DB api 'withdrawTestBalance' \
+taler-wallet-cli --no-throttle --wallet-db=$WALLET_DB api --expect-success 'withdrawTestBalance' \
"$(jq -n '
{
amount: "TESTKUDOS:100",
bankBaseUrl: $BANK_URL,
exchangeBaseUrl: $EXCHANGE_URL
}' \
- --arg BANK_URL "$BANK_URL" \
+ --arg BANK_URL "${BANK_URL}demobanks/default/access-api/" \
--arg EXCHANGE_URL "$EXCHANGE_URL"
- )" 2> /dev/null >/dev/null
-taler-wallet-cli --wallet-db=$WALLET_DB run-until-done 2>/dev/null >/dev/null
+ )" 2> wallet-withdraw.err > wallet-withdraw.out
+taler-wallet-cli --wallet-db=$WALLET_DB \
+ run-until-done 2>wallet-withdraw-finish.err >wallet-withdraw-finish.out
echo " OK"
echo -en "Making payments for truth uploads ... "
@@ -413,12 +414,14 @@ do
PAY_URI=`jq --argjson INDEX $INDEX -r -e '.payments[$INDEX]' < $B2FILE`
# run wallet CLI
echo -n "$INDEX"
- taler-wallet-cli --wallet-db=$WALLET_DB handle-uri $PAY_URI -y 2>/dev/null >/dev/null
+ taler-wallet-cli --wallet-db=$WALLET_DB \
+ handle-uri $PAY_URI -y 2>wallet-pay-truth-$INDEX.err >wallet-pay-truth-$INDEX.out
echo -n ", "
done
echo "OK"
echo -e "Running wallet run-pending..."
-taler-wallet-cli --wallet-db=$WALLET_DB run-pending 2>/dev/null >/dev/null
+taler-wallet-cli --wallet-db=$WALLET_DB \
+ run-pending 2>wallet-pay-truth-finish-$INDEX.err >wallet-pay-truth-finish-$INDEX.out
echo -e "Payments done"
export B2FILE
@@ -436,12 +439,13 @@ do
PAY_URI=`jq --argjson INDEX $INDEX -r -e '.policy_payment_requests[$INDEX].payto' < $B2FILE`
# run wallet CLI
echo -n "$INDEX"
- taler-wallet-cli --wallet-db=$WALLET_DB handle-uri $PAY_URI -y 2>/dev/null >/dev/null
+ taler-wallet-cli --wallet-db=$WALLET_DB handle-uri $PAY_URI -y 2>wallet-pay-policy-$INDEX.err >wallet-pay-policy-$INDEX.out
echo -n ", "
done
echo " OK"
echo -en "Running wallet run-pending..."
-taler-wallet-cli --wallet-db=$WALLET_DB run-pending 2>/dev/null >/dev/null
+taler-wallet-cli --wallet-db=$WALLET_DB \
+ run-pending 2>wallet-pay-policy-finish.err >wallet-pay-policy-finish.out
echo -e " payments DONE"
echo -en "Try to upload again ..."